Why Duct Cleaning Matters in Mansfield

The local climate and environment in North Texas create unique challenges for your home's ventilation system. Mansfield experiences dry, windy conditions that carry significant amounts of dust and pollen, which are easily pulled into your HVAC system 1. Furthermore, the high humidity levels, especially during spring and fall, can promote mold growth inside ductwork, particularly in attic spaces where many air handlers are located 2. For a system that runs nearly year-round to combat Texas heat, this rapid accumulation of contaminants can strain your HVAC unit, reduce its efficiency, and circulate irritants throughout your living spaces.

Regular air duct maintenance addresses these specific issues. By removing the built-up debris, you allow your system to operate with less effort, which can lead to lower energy bills and extend the equipment's lifespan 3. More importantly, it reduces the concentration of airborne particles that can aggravate allergies and respiratory conditions, making your home's air cleaner and safer to breathe.

The Professional Duct Cleaning Process: What to Expect

Reputable service providers in Mansfield follow a detailed, multi-step methodology to ensure a comprehensive cleaning. Understanding this process can help you know what a quality service entails.

1. Initial Inspection and Preparation A technician will first conduct a visual inspection of your HVAC system, often using specialized cameras. They will then seal off all supply and return registers with protective coverings and use drop cloths to protect your floors and furnishings from any dislodged debris 4 5.

2. Creating Negative Pressure The core of the professional method involves attaching a high-powered, commercial-grade vacuum to the main trunk line of your duct system. This truck-mounted or portable unit creates powerful negative pressure throughout the entire network of ducts. This suction ensures that all loosened contaminants are pulled directly to the vacuum and prevented from escaping into your home 6 7.

3. Agitation and Dislodging Debris With the vacuum running, technicians use specialized tools to agitate the interior surfaces of the ducts. These can include long, flexible brushes, air whips, or compressed air nozzles that scrub and vibrate dust, mold, and debris loose from the metal walls.

4. Cleaning All System Components A full service doesn't stop at the ducts. The cleaning encompasses all accessible parts of the air distribution system:

  • Supply and return air ducts and vents.
  • Grilles, registers, and diffusers.
  • The blower motor and housing.
  • The evaporator coil and drain pan (if accessible).
  • The air handler unit itself 8.

5. Optional Sanitization and Final Walkthrough For homes with concerns about mold, bacteria, or odors, an EPA-approved antimicrobial solution can be fogged or sprayed into the ducts after cleaning 9. The service concludes with a final inspection to ensure everything is reassembled correctly and that airflow is restored.

Determining the Right Cleaning Schedule for Your Home

How often you need this service depends on several household factors. For a typical Mansfield home without special circumstances, a general recommendation is every 3 to 5 years 10. However, certain conditions warrant more frequent attention:

  • Households with Pets, Allergies, or Smokers: Pet dander and smoke residues accumulate quickly. Cleaning every 2 to 3 years is often advised to maintain air quality 11 12.
  • After Recent Construction or Renovation: New builds and remodeling projects in Mansfield's growing communities generate substantial drywall dust and sawdust. Having your ducts cleaned within the first year of project completion is highly recommended to remove this abrasive debris 13.
  • Visible Mold Growth or Pest Infestation: If you see mold or evidence of rodents or insects in your ductwork, immediate cleaning and sanitization are necessary.
  • Clogged Dryer Vents: While a separate service, it's important to note that dryer vent cleaning should be performed annually to prevent a serious fire hazard 14.

Key Factors Influencing Cost in Mansfield

The price for residential air duct cleaning in Mansfield can vary based on the specifics of your home. Many local companies offer free, no-obligation estimates 15. Here are the primary factors that affect the final cost:

  • Size of the Home and HVAC System: Larger homes with more square footage and multiple HVAC systems will cost more to clean than smaller, single-system homes.
  • Number of Vents and Registers: Pricing is often partially based on the count of supply and return vents, as each requires individual attention.
  • Accessibility and Complexity of Ductwork: Easily accessible, straight duct runs are simpler to clean than complex systems with many tight turns or sections that are difficult to reach.
  • Level of Contamination: Heavily soiled ducts or those requiring mold remediation may involve more time and specialized treatments.
  • Additional Services: Adding duct sanitization, dryer vent cleaning, or furnace/AC tune-ups will increase the total.

For a basic cleaning service, prices can start around $129, though this often covers a limited number of vents 16. A full, comprehensive cleaning for an average-sized Mansfield home typically ranges from $300 to $500 17 18. It's wise to get detailed estimates from a few providers to compare the scope of services included at each price point.

Choosing a Qualified Service Provider

Selecting the right company is as important as the service itself. Look for providers whose technicians are certified by the National Air Duct Cleaners Association (NADCA) 19. NADCA certification indicates training in proper cleaning standards and industry best practices. Additionally, choose licensed, insured companies with a strong local reputation in Mansfield. Be cautious of door-to-door sales or companies offering extremely low "whole-house specials," as these can sometimes be scams that provide subpar service. A trustworthy company will be happy to explain their process, provide a detailed written estimate, and answer all your questions before starting work.
